Watercolor Wings Double Slider Card



 
It has been a long time since I've made a Double Slider card and they are not that hard to make especially with this easy to follow video from Julie Davison HERE .  I used to use a plastic bag for the sliding mechanism but Julie cut 1-1/4" off of a large cellophane bag. Even though this technique is an oldie but a goodie, I wanted to use my new Watercolor Wings stamp set that came yesterday with the Bold Butterfly Framelits as a Bundle.  Of course, I had to use my favorite colors Bermuda Bay, Pool Party and Island Indigo.  I also used the 1-1/4" Bermuda Bay Striped Grosgrain Ribbon, Island Indigo 1/4" Cotton Ribbon and the Bermuda Bay Baker's Twine.  Hope you like it!
